A new grid-associated algorithm in the distributed hydrological model simulations

来源 :Science China(Technological Sciences) | 被引量 : 0次 | 上传用户:purong0826
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
This paper presents a new grid-associated algorithm to improve the performance of a D8 algorithm based distributed hydrological model computation.The algorithm is based on the well known single-flow D8 algorithm of grid flow.This algorithm allocates calculation priorities according to the distance between the units and the outlet,then carries out the ergodic computations of the hydrological units according to the priority division.For the parallelized algorithm,a standard thread-level shared memory system for parallel programming(OpenMP-Open specifications for Multi Processing) was introduced,and the parallel coding was implemented in C lan-guage.A case study showed that the absolute speed-up ratio of the grid-associated algorithm is 1.64 over the original D8 algorithm,and the linear speed-up ratio of the parallel associated algorithm is 2.42 under 4 cores.The parallel grid-associated algorithm can be applied to a variety of research fields that use the grid method. This paper presents a new grid-associated algorithm to improve the performance of a D8 algorithm based distributed hydrological model computation. Algorithm based on the well known single-flow D8 algorithm of grid flow. This algorithm allocates calculation priorities according to the distance between the units and the outlet, then carries out the ergodic computations of the hydrological units according to the priority division. For the parallelized algorithm, a standard thread-level shared memory system for parallel programming (OpenMP-Open specifications for Multi Processing) was introduced, and the parallel coding was implemented in C lan-guage. A case study showed that the absolute speed-up ratio of the grid-associated algorithm is 1.64 over the original D8 algorithm, and the linear speed-up ratio of the parallel associated algorithm is 2.42 under 4 cores. The parallel grid-associated algorithm can be applied to a variety of research fields that use the grid method.
其他文献
选取深圳市城镇及农村居民、工厂工人和特殊人群2073人,进行了甲、乙、丙、丁和戊型病毒性肝炎感染状况监测。感染率分别为65.6%、78.4%、4.11%、5.43%和11.59%;据此提出了本病的防治策略。通过分析乙肝感染标
虚拟社区有自己独特的价值标准和行为模式,因而其道德的构建也具有特殊性。网络行为的失控不但需要具体的规制措施,同时也需要一种新道德来约束和指导,对规制机制形成一个很
问题1如图1,在抛物线y~2=2px中,直线AB过焦点F,B在准线l上的射影为B_1,则直线AB_1是否过定点O(0,0)? Problem 1 As shown in Fig. 1, in the parabola y~2=2px, the straigh
吸烟对消化性溃疡愈合及复发的影响(附176例临床分析)上海市徐汇区中心医院内科张华伦消化性溃疡是内科常见疾病,经有效的药物治疗,70%~90%的胃溃疡和十二指肠球部溃疡患者4周即可愈合。亦有
目的探索高原运动员生理变化特点和规律。方法 在海拔 2260 m、 2 630m和 396 m二次高平原交替训练期间,对12名高原男子中长跑运动员进行血象、心肺功能等测试研究。结果现示上更高高度(海拔2 630m)进
岁月隆隆辗过,滔滔的流水漫山遍野地奔走,不舍昼夜。以青山为主题,以卵石为伙伴,用无形的腰肢,撰写一首千回百转或飞泻千里的长诗。 朗读流水,需读懂流水的声音。这些在河床
跨越式跳高是中学体育教学中的重要教学内容,同时它又是田径项目之一。从动作结构上看,有助跑、起跳、过杆和落地等技术组成;从技术上分析看,起跳是跨越式跳高的关键,特别是
本文从三个大方面阐述了中国改革开放的总设计师邓小平的改革观。首先,邓小平把“什么是社会主义,如何建设社会主义”问题放在改革的核心地位,提出了社会主义本质论;其次,把
武汉市江汉区黄陂街小学已经走过80年的办学历程。美丽的校园令人由衷地感受到教育者的“慧心”和与时俱进的匠心。学校围绕“建设生活的花园,培育智慧 Huanghan Street, Ji
2013年4月国家质检总局公布8400多吨不合格奶粉,来自新西兰、澳大利亚、智利和韩国,不合格的项目包括铜含量、维生素B12、胆碱、维生素B6等含量不符合国家标准要求。2013年1